Patent classifications
G06F40/268
Method of browsing a resource through voice interaction
Computer-implemented method of browsing a resource through voice interaction comprising the following steps: A. acquiring (100) from a user a request aimed at browsing a resource; B. downloading (130) the requested resource; C. performing a syntactic parsing (135) of the downloaded resource; D. extracting (150) from the downloaded resource one or more lists, if any, of selectable shortcuts pointing to portions inside or outside the downloaded resource through a syntactic analysis and/or a semantic analysis and/or a morphological-visual analysis of extraction of lists of selectable shortcuts on the basis of an ontology (245) corresponding to the type of resource; E. on the basis of the ontology (245) corresponding to the type of resource, building (225) a list of one or more lists of selectable shortcuts extracted in step D ordered according to a list prioritisation; F. extracting (150) from the downloaded resource one or more content elements through a syntactic analysis and/or a semantic analysis and/or a morphological-visual analysis of extraction of content elements on the basis of the ontology (245) corresponding to the type of resource; G. on the basis of the ontology (245) corresponding to the type of resource, building (290) a list of content elements extracted in step F ordered according to a content element prioritisation; H. on the basis of the lists built in steps E and G and on the basis of the ontology (245) corresponding to the type of resource, building a final structure of lists of selectable shortcuts and of content elements; I. playing (125) a voice prompt based on the final structure and starting a voice interaction with the user for browsing the resource.
WORKFLOW GENERATION SUPPORT APPARATUS, WORKFLOW GENERATION SUPPORT METHOD AND WORKFLOW GENERATION SUPPORT PROGRAM
A business flow creation support device 1 includes a generation unit 11 that receives an effect and a sentence indicating what is desired to be realized, which are input by a user, and generates a flow including a plurality of clauses obtained by morphologically analyzing the sentence, a presentation unit 12 that acquires scores indicating to which fields the effect and words included in the clauses are close, respectively, and presents, to the user, a template of a business flow in a field having a high total score, and a creation support unit 14 that support creation of the business flow corresponding to the effect and the sentence.
DOCUMENT RETRIEVAL SYSTEM
A document retrieval system that retrieves documents, with concepts of the documents taken into account, is provided. The document retrieval system (100) includes an input unit (101), a first processing unit (102), a storage unit (105), a second processing unit (103), and an output unit (104). The input unit (101) has a function of inputting a first document (20), the first processing unit (102) has a function of creating a first graph structure (21) from the first document (20), the storage unit (105) has a function of storing a second graph structure (11), the second processing unit (103) has a function of calculating a similarity between the first graph structure (21) and the second graph structure (11), the output unit (104) has a function of supplying information, the first processing unit (102) has a function of dividing the first document (20) into a plurality of tokens, a node and an edge of the first graph structure (21) have a label, and the label includes the plurality of tokens.
DOCUMENT RETRIEVAL SYSTEM
A document retrieval system that retrieves documents, with concepts of the documents taken into account, is provided. The document retrieval system (100) includes an input unit (101), a first processing unit (102), a storage unit (105), a second processing unit (103), and an output unit (104). The input unit (101) has a function of inputting a first document (20), the first processing unit (102) has a function of creating a first graph structure (21) from the first document (20), the storage unit (105) has a function of storing a second graph structure (11), the second processing unit (103) has a function of calculating a similarity between the first graph structure (21) and the second graph structure (11), the output unit (104) has a function of supplying information, the first processing unit (102) has a function of dividing the first document (20) into a plurality of tokens, a node and an edge of the first graph structure (21) have a label, and the label includes the plurality of tokens.
Threshold-based assembly of remote automated assistant responses
Techniques are described herein for assembling/evaluating automated assistant responses for privacy concerns. In various implementations, a free-form natural language input may be received from a first user and may include a request for information pertaining to a second user. Multiple data sources may be identified that are accessible by an automated assistant to retrieve data associated with the second user. The multiple data sources may collectively include sufficient data to formulate a natural language response to the request. Respective privacy scores associated with the multiple data sources may be used to determine an aggregate privacy score associated with responding to the request. The natural language response may then be output at a client device operated by the first user in response to a determination that the aggregate privacy score associated with the natural language response satisfies a privacy criterion established for the second user with respect to the first user.
METHOD AND APPARATUS FOR PROCESSING NATURAL LANGUAGE TEXT, DEVICE AND STORAGE MEDIUM
A method and apparatus for processing a natural language text, a device and a storage medium are provided. An implementation of the method includes: after obtaining a target sentence text to be processed, performing word segmentation on the target sentence text, to obtain a target fixed word slot corresponding to the target sentence text and candidate free word slots corresponding to the target sentence text; then performing, based on syntax rules of preset standard sentence patterns, sentence pattern matching on the target fixed word slot and the candidate free word slots, to obtain a target sentence pattern including the target fixed word slot and a target free word slot; and replacing the target free word slot in the target sentence pattern with a free word corresponding to the target free word slot in the target sentence text, to obtain a target sentence pattern including the free word.
Method and apparatus for recommending word
Provided is a device including a memory storing information about sequences of a plurality of registered words; an input unit comprising input circuitry configured to receive an input of a text comprising a first eojeol not belonging to the plurality of registered words, wherein, in the first eojeol, a first word is attached to a first registered word that belongs to the plurality of registered words; and a controller configured to detect the first registered word from the first eojeol, to determine a predicted eojeol to be input after the text, based on the information about the sequences of the plurality of registered words and the detected first registered word and to control a display to display the predicted eojeol.
Method and apparatus for recommending word
Provided is a device including a memory storing information about sequences of a plurality of registered words; an input unit comprising input circuitry configured to receive an input of a text comprising a first eojeol not belonging to the plurality of registered words, wherein, in the first eojeol, a first word is attached to a first registered word that belongs to the plurality of registered words; and a controller configured to detect the first registered word from the first eojeol, to determine a predicted eojeol to be input after the text, based on the information about the sequences of the plurality of registered words and the detected first registered word and to control a display to display the predicted eojeol.
SYSTEMS AND METHODS FOR COMPRESSION-BASED SEARCH ENGINE
A system described herein may provide a technique for the compression of query terms and search data against which the query terms may be evaluated. The compression may be dynamic, in that a quantity of bits used to compress the search data and query terms may be based on a quantity of unique characters included in a given query term. The compression may further include reducing the volume of search data by compressing entire words, that do not include any of the unique characters of the query term, to one particular code.
SYSTEMS AND METHODS FOR COMPRESSION-BASED SEARCH ENGINE
A system described herein may provide a technique for the compression of query terms and search data against which the query terms may be evaluated. The compression may be dynamic, in that a quantity of bits used to compress the search data and query terms may be based on a quantity of unique characters included in a given query term. The compression may further include reducing the volume of search data by compressing entire words, that do not include any of the unique characters of the query term, to one particular code.